What is DIGIPIN?
DIGIPIN (Digital Postal Index Number) is India Post's new, open-source, nationwide digital addressing system. Developed with IIT Hyderabad, NRSC, and ISRO, DIGIPIN divides India into a grid of 4m x 4m squares, each assigned a unique 10-character alphanumeric code based on latitude and longitude.
- Precision: Pinpoints exact locations, unlike traditional PIN codes that cover large areas.
- Efficiency: Streamlines deliveries, logistics, and emergency services.
- Inclusivity: Useful in rural or unstructured areas where addresses may not exist.
- Privacy: No personal data is stored or linked to a DIGIPIN; it is purely a geospatial reference.
- Offline Capable: The system can be used offline, and the encoding/decoding logic is public.
How does it work? India is divided into a grid (Latitude: 2.5°–38.5° N, Longitude: 63.5°–99.5° E). Each 4m x 4m cell is assigned a unique 10-character code using 16 symbols. The code is generated by hierarchically subdividing the bounding box and encoding the location's latitude and longitude at each level.
Use Cases: E-commerce, logistics, emergency services, government, and individuals for precise, easy-to-share digital addresses. Your postal address remains unchanged; DIGIPIN is an additional, precise digital layer.

The pincode 284402 corresponds to 9 post offices in Lalitpur district
A single pincode is not limited to just one post office; a single postal code can be assigned to multiple post offices within the same region.
In the case of pincode 284402, it is assigned to 9 different post offices, which include Marrauli bo, Paah bo, Pura kakdari bo, Sunwaha bo, Kailguwan bo, Billa bo, Kuagaon bo, Udaipura bo and Banpur so lalitpur.
These post offices, associated with pincode 284402, are located in the Lalitpur district of Uttar pradesh state. To learn more about each individual post office, click on the respective name in the list below.
